    Abstract
    Addresses the problem of data modelling in information retrieval introducing various aspects and issues that are necessarily taken into account when designing and developing an information retrieval system. Pays particular attention to the representation of different types of data managed by an information retrieval application: structured and unstructured data. A recently introduced information retrieval, data modelling approach supports the notion of a schema permitting representation of the information retrieval data on 2 different levels: intensional and extensional. presents the characteristics of this data modelling approach here together with examples of its use in a working prototype
